The Phenomenology Collective

Turning philosophy into applied academic research. The Phenomenology Collective explores how phenomenology moves from philosophy to academic research. Each episode unpacks key concepts, hosts thoughtful conversations with researchers and practitioners, and reflects on how lived experience can reshape how we see the world. Episode 4: From Positivism to Phenomenology: Letting Go of Certainty (with Jade Sampford) 08.04.2026

What happens when the numbers are no longer enough? In this episode of The Phenomenology Collective , we explore the philosophical shift from positivism to phenomenology—a transition many researchers make when they realise that measurement alone cannot capture the fullness of human experience. Episode 3: In the Weeds: The Lived Experience of Phenomenological Data Analysis (with Liz Shaw) 08.04.2026

What does it actually feel like to analyse data phenomenologically? In this episode of The Phenomenology Collective , we step into one of the most challenging—and often isolating—phases of phenomenological research: data analysis. Episode 2: Creative Methods in Phenomenology: Ecomaps, Poetry and Plays (with Dr Liz Jestico) 08.04.2026

In this episode of The Phenomenology Collective , we explore one of the most exciting—and unsettling—spaces in phenomenological research: the use of creative methods. Without a fixed “how-to” guide, phenomenological researchers are often required to think carefully—and creatively—about how to access and represent lived experience. But how far can we go? Episode 1: What Is Phenomenology — and Why Does It Matter? 02.03.2026

In this introductory episode of The Phenomenology Collective , hosts Dr Lewis Barrett-Rodger and Dr Sally Goldspink offer a gentle but rigorous orientation to phenomenology for listeners who are new to the approach.
